Wang Ji Hae learns of Song Jong Ho's plans and showed how angered she was.

On the episode of SBS Monday/Tuesday drama "The Suspicious Housekeeper" broadcast on November 18th, Yoon Song Wha (played by Wang Ji Hae) was upset hearing about Jang Do Hyun (played by Song Jong Ho)'s plans.

Yoon Song Wha secretly looked at his book to find evidence that Jang Do Hyung was actually Suh Ji Hoon.

At this time, Jang Do Hyung appeared suddenly and said, "I burned al the pictures.  In case you would do something that was pointless."

Yoon Song Wha was startled and asked Jang Do Hyung why he had called her.

At this, Jang Do Hyung said, "I said I'd leave but I thought I'd have to keep my promise.  This all went well because you didn't peep a word" and asked where she was going.

Yoon Song Hwa said, "I'm going for 'Habitat for Humanities'  I'm going to only the undeveloped places in the world so don't you think about looking for me." 

Lastly, she asked, "Can I ask one thing?  Now what you going to do.  If you die or something what will happen to Bok Nyuh?"

At that, Jang Do Hyung made a creepy smile and said, "What would happen then?  I guess you could take that woman.  Do you get it now?  Why I came back despite all the risks?"

At this, Yoon Song Wha said, "You're really selfish.  Your love.  Is that kind of obsession even called love?" and was upset.
